編集の要約なし |
|||
17行目: | 17行目: | ||
==メソッド== | ==メソッド== | ||
* | * getInstance* - デフォルトのロケールを使用してインスタンスを取得する | ||
* [[Calendar.getTimeZone|getTimeZone]] - タイムゾーンを取得する | * [[Calendar.getTimeZone|getTimeZone]] - タイムゾーンを取得する | ||
* [[Calendar.get|get]] - フィールドの値を返す | * [[Calendar.get|get]] - フィールドの値を返す | ||
* [[Calendar.set|set]] - フィールドに値をセットする | * [[Calendar.set|set]] - フィールドに値をセットする | ||
* [[Calendar.getTime|getTime]] - Dateオブジェクトを返す | * [[Calendar.getTime|getTime]] - Dateオブジェクトを返す |
2019年6月28日 (金) 20:39時点における版
私は、カレンダーの日時を扱います。次週の日付の取得などのカレンダ・フィールド操作ができます。
フィールド
- public static final int DATE - 日付
- public static final int DAY_OF_MONTH - DATEと同義
- public static final int MONTH - 月(JANUARY:0)
- public static final int DAY_OF_WEEK - 曜日
- public static final int WEEK_OF_MONTH - 週番号
- public static final int DAY_OF_YEAR - 年の何日目か
- public static final int DST_OFFSET - 夏時間のオフセット
- protected long time - 現在設定されている時間をエポックから経過ミリ秒数で
コンストラクタ
- protected Calendar() - デフォルトのタイムゾーンを使用してCalendarを生成
メソッド
- getInstance* - デフォルトのロケールを使用してインスタンスを取得する
- getTimeZone - タイムゾーンを取得する
- get - フィールドの値を返す
- set - フィールドに値をセットする
- getTime - Dateオブジェクトを返す